INTERCOLLEGIATE ATHLETICS FEE. The number and type of sports offered for men and women don’t have to be the same but there does need to be an equitable opportunity to play. Female and male student athletes must receive scholarship dollars proportional to their participation levels in sports. Title IX’s requirements of Athletics can be divided into three basic categories: Men and women must be given equitable opportunities to participate in University sponsored athletics.
